How they compare

Bolivia, Plurinational State of currently reports 9.9% against 9.7% in United States, a difference of 0.2%.

Across all 25 years both countries report, Bolivia, Plurinational State of has been ahead every year.

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 37th and United States ranks 40th of 163 countries.

Bolivia, Plurinational State of has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bolivia, Plurinational State of United States Difference Ahead
2000s 9.0% 7.9% 1.1% Bolivia, Plurinational State of
2010s 8.9% 8.4% 0.5% Bolivia, Plurinational State of
2020s 9.4% 9.3% 0.2% Bolivia, Plurinational State of

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
